At the Manor House, you will find a restful haven in a building with a history dating back to the beginning of the 19th century. In 1847 Henry Fancourt White established a workers' base at the foot of the Outeniqua Mountains for the construction of the Montagu Pass. Now a National Monument, the Manor House with its 34 bedrooms is situated in wooded parkland and is the perfect base for your leisure.
